Although Brahms was just 50 when he wrote his Third Symphony, he looked back to younger days with the musical quotation of the motto Frei aber froh (“Free but happy”). In the rising exclamation from the winds that open this great symphony, the F-A-F motif hits you immediately. The compactness of the work intensifies ... Apr 1, 2021 · 2:00 PM on Apr 1, 2021 CDT. Comprised of approximately 100 members, high school seniors or younger, the Philharmonic is a full symphony … The Dallas Symphony Orchestra traces its origins to a concert given by a group of 40 musicians conducted by Hans Kreissig in 1900. Born in Germany, Kreissig studied composition and conducting with Arthur Sullivan in London and served as accompanist to the English cornet player Jules Levy. He left for the States in 1883 as part of a touring ... As the largest performing arts organization in the Southwest, the DSO is committed to inspiring the broadest possible audience with …Motoi Takeda joined the Dallas Symphony Orchestra in 1977 and became Associate Concertmaster in 1987. He studied violin in Japan and at the Moscow Conservatory, where he received his music diploma. He then attended The Juilliard School on full scholarship. He has performed in recitals and as a guest soloist with orchestras worldwide. His 1999 ...Jean Sibelius (1865–1957): Symphony No. 2 in D Major, Op. 43.
